| # The following tailoring is an adjustment of the DUCET collation |
| # order for ANUSVARA, CANDRABINDU, and VISARGA. Instead of being |
| # sorted with secondary weights, they are collated on primary level |
| # before the independent vowels. CANDRABINDU is secondary different |
| # from ANUSVARA. This gives a sort order very close to the referenced |
| # dictionaries. The sort order in the dictionaries, which by the way |
| # are not exactly the same, require quite extensive tailoring. |
